如何搭建Shadowsocks服务器:详细教程和配置指南

如何搭建Shadowsocks服务器

介绍

Shadowsocks是一个开源的代理软件,可以用于科学上网和保护用户隐私。本教程将指导您如何搭建Shadowsocks服务器。

步骤

  1. 购买服务器
    • 选择可靠的云服务提供商,如阿里云、腾讯云或AWS。
    • 选择合适的服务器配置,确保满足您的需求。
  2. 配置服务器
    • 登录到您的服务器控制台。
    • 安装操作系统,推荐使用Ubuntu或CentOS。
  3. 安装Shadowsocks
    • 使用SSH连接到服务器。
    • 安装Shadowsocks软件包。
  4. 配置Shadowsocks
    • 编辑配置文件,设置端口号、密码等参数。
    • 启动Shadowsocks服务。
  5. 连接到Shadowsocks服务器
    • 在本地设备上安装Shadowsocks客户端。
    • 输入服务器IP、端口号、密码等信息。
    • 连接成功后,即可享受安全的网络连接。

常见问题

如何测试Shadowsocks服务器是否工作?

您可以使用网络工具,如Ping或Telnet,测试服务器是否可访问。另外,您还可以使用Shadowsocks客户端连接服务器,并尝试访问被墙的网站。

如何优化Shadowsocks服务器的性能?

您可以尝试更改服务器配置,如调整带宽、优化加密算法等。此外,确保服务器网络稳定也是提高性能的关键。

如何解决Shadowsocks连接速度慢的问题?

首先,您可以尝试更换服务器位置,选择速度更快的节点。其次,检查您的本地网络连接,确保网络稳定。最后,尝试优化Shadowsocks配置,如调整加密算法等。

结论

通过本教程,您学会了如何搭建和配置Shadowsocks服务器,希望能帮助您实现安全的网络连接和科学上网。

正文完